The water hardness test measures the amount of limestone in the water. Easy to use, the method is to drop the test solution to 5 ml of water in a filled measuring cylinder; each drop corresponds to 1 f. The water hardness is the number of drops until the colour change of the solution pays. A water is used as limestone from 20ºF. The solution allows more than 20 pistons with hardness measurements (2 vials test provided). To measure the hardness of the water at the entrance of the house. A hard water (Th> 20°F) deteriorates devices, additional consumption and additional costs in detergents. Useful to check the operation of a water softening system or to change the setting. The test can be performed on a sample of 5 ml of water; one drop of the test solution corresponds to 1 f. to refine the measurement, the test can be carried out on an amount of 10 ml of water; 1 drop of the test solution corresponds to 0.5 °F. The water hardness test must be carried out at the entrance of the house (with the exception of a water softener setting)
